A square lawn in front of a house is of 40 feet diagonal. What is the perimeter of the lawn in feet? (round off 0.5 ft and above to 1 foot).

(1) 84
(2) 121
(3) 113
(4) 96
(5) 102

The answer is choice 3 - 113 units.

Diagonal = a * Sqrt 2 = 40
Therefore, a = 20 * sqrt 2
Perimeter = 4a = 80 * sqrt 2 => 80 * 1.4 = 112 units...approx. to choice 3.
